Black Sober vs Moss Marble
Anacampsis temerella compared with Celypha aurofasciana
Key Differences
- Black Sober is Endangered while Moss Marble is Vulnerable.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black Sober | Moss Marble |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order same |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Gelechiidae | Tortricidae |
| Genus | Anacampsis | Celypha |
| Species | Anacampsis temerella | Celypha aurofasciana |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black Sober and Moss Marble share a common ancestor at the Order level: Lepidoptera. (Butterflies & Moths)
